Kwara State Government Constitutes Committee for Mega Empowerment Programme

Date: 2024-12-02

The Kwara state government has established a committee to oversee a mega empowerment programme, which is expected to benefit thousands of Kwarans, including business owners, petty traders, artisans, and people living with disabilities, as reported by Informant 247.

The programme is part of the state government's efforts to improve the living conditions of its citizens and boost the local economy.

The committee, which is responsible for overseeing the empowerment process, met with stakeholders from various demographics on Friday and reaffirmed its commitment to supporting the government in making the programme a success.

According to the chairperson of the committee, Deputy Chief of Staff (DCOS) Princess Bukola Babalola, the mega empowerment programme is a key initiative of the Governor AbdulRahman AbdulRazaq-led administration to improve the lives of the people of Kwara State.
